SGOT and SGPT
Dear sir, I got my LFT done and following things came in my report SGOT 110 SGPT 150.6 BILIRUBIN DIRECT 0.5 Feeling nausea, fatigue and weakness from last 10 days. Kindly suggest is it a mild infection or thing of concern.

Your liver function tests (LFTs) show: SGOT (AST): 110 U/L – raised SGPT (ALT): 150.6 U/L – raised Direct bilirubin: 0.5 mg/dL – normal Mild elevations of AST and ALT can occur due to viral hepatitis, medication or toxin-related liver stress, fatty liver, or other infections. Your symptoms of nausea, fatigue, and weakness for 10 days suggest your liver is under some stress and needs careful evaluation. General Advice: Avoid alcohol and hepatotoxic medications (like excess paracetamol or herbal supplements). Eat a light, balanced diet, avoiding fried and processed foods. Stay hydrated and rest adequately. What to monitor / when to worry: Monitor for yellowing of eyes or skin, persistent vomiting, dark urine, severe abdominal pain. Note if fatigue or nausea worsens. Medicine / supplements: Do not start any liver medications or supplements without a doctor’s prescription. When to consult a doctor immediately: Jaundice (yellow eyes or skin) Persistent vomiting or inability to eat/drink Severe abdominal pain or confusion ✅ Next steps: Schedule an appointment with a physician or gastroenterologist/hepatologist for detailed evaluation. They may order ultrasound of liver, viral hepatitis markers, and repeat LFTs to identify the cause. If your symptoms persist or worsen, I strongly recommend consulting a doctor promptly.
